5个PLC编程实例,高级电工的水平,弄懂后可以去考技师了
最近很多的电工师傅都在问,怎么样学习PLC?怎么可以快速的上手?有没有什么学习PLC的捷径?等等诸如此类的问题,其实老电工师傅们都知道,学习PLC,特别是想要快速掌握PLC,不仅仅需要一定的理论知识,还需要不断的实践实践再实践,多点练习自然也就会了,今天我们重点来看5个PLC编程的例子,每个例子都有具体的要求以及解决方案,包括了怎么用PLC的思维去处理问题?怎么进行分析?怎么进行具体的编程?每一个例子都详细的进行了梯形图以及逻辑语言的编程,想要学习的朋友可以看看,都是电工师傅的经验总结,非常实用。
西门子PLC高级应用,先学plc基础,再学进阶篇
本书从实用的角度出发,全部用实例讲解西门子S7-200/S7-1200/300/400 PLC的高级应用,包括梯形图的编写方法、PLC在过程控制中应用、PLC在运动控制中的应用、PLC的通信及其通信模块的应用、PLC在变频器调速系统中的应用、PLC软件仿真和PLC故障诊断;用工程实际的开发过程详细介绍了每个实例,便于读者模仿学习;每个实例都有详细的软件、硬件配置清单,并配有接线图和程序。本书的资源中有重点内容的程序和操作视频资料。
在编写过程中,我们将一些生动的操作实例融入到实际中,以期提高读者的学习兴趣。本书与其他相关书籍相比,具有以下特点。
① 用实例引导读者学习。本书的内容全部用精选的例子讲解。例如,用例子说明现场总线通信的实现的全过程。
② 所有的例子都包含软硬件的配置方案图、接线图和程序,而且为确保程序的正确性,程序已经在PLC上运行通过。
③ 对于比较复杂的例子,与之配套的学习资源中有录像和程序源代码。如工业以太网通信的硬件组态较复杂,就配有录像和程序源代码,读者可以在出版社的网站上下载,便于学习。
PLC入门级点击
拖动右侧滚动条可以查看全目录▼
前言
第1章梯形图的编程方法与调试
11功能图
111功能图的画法
112梯形图编程的原则
12逻辑控制的梯形图编程方法
121经验设计法
122功能图设计法
13编程小技巧
131电动机的控制
132定时器和计数器应用
133取代特殊功能的小程序
134单键起停控制(乒乓控制)
14仿真软件的应用
141S7-200 PLC的仿真软件的使用
142S7-300/400 PLC的仿真软件的使用
15S7-300/400 PLC调试方法
151用变量监控表进行调试
152使用交叉参考和符号表的导入/输出
16综合应用
第2章PLC在过程控制中的应用
21PID控制简介
211PID控制原理简介
212PID控制的算法和图解
213PID控制器的参数整定
22用S7-200/300/400 PLC进行电炉的温度控制
221利用S7-200 PLC进行电炉的温度控制
222利用S7-300/400 PLC进行电炉的温度控制
第3章PLC在运动控制中的应用
31PLC的步进电动机控制
311直接使用PLC的高速输出点控制步进电动机
312使用定位模块控制步进电动机
313S7-200 PLC控制步进电动机的调速
314步进电动机的正反转
32PLC的伺服控制
321直接使用PLC的高速输出点控制三菱伺服系统
322S7-200 PLC的高速输出点控制西门子伺服系统
323使用现场总线控制伺服电系统
第4章PLC的通信及其通信模块的应用
41通信基础知识
411通信的基本概念
412PLC网络的术语解释
413RS-485标准串行接口
414OSI参考模型
415SIMATIC NET 工业网络
42现场总线概述
421现场总线的概念
422主流现场总线简介
423现场总线的特点
424现场总线的现状
425现场总线的发展
43PPI通信
431PPI协议简介
432S7-200 PLC之间的PPI通信
44自由口通信
441自由口通信简介
442S7-200 PLC之间的自由口通信
443智能设备与S7-200 PLC之间的自由口通信
45Modbus通信
451Modbus协议简介
452S7-200 PLC之间的Modbus通信
453S7-1200 PLC之间的Modbus通信
46MPI通信
461MPI通信简介
462S7-200 PLC与S7-300 PLC之间的MPI通信
463S7-300 PLC之间的MPI通信
464S7-300/400 PLC与S7-400 PLC之间的MPI通信
47PROFIBUS-DP通信
471PROFIBUS-DP通信简介
472S7-300 PLC与ET200M之间的PROFIBUS-DP通信
473S7-300 PLC与S7-200 PLC之间的PROFIBUS-DP通信
474S7-300 PLC之间的PROFIBUS-DP通信
48以太网通信
481以太网通信简介
482S7-200 PLC与S7-300 PLC之间的以太网通信
483S7-300 PLC之间的以太网通信
484S7-400 PLC与远程IO模块ET200之间的PROFINET通信
第5章PLC在变频器调速系统中的应用
51西门子MM440变频器
511认识变频器
512西门子MM440变频器使用简介
52变频器多段速度给定
53变频器模拟量速度给定
531模拟量模块简介
532模拟量速度给定(利用S7-200 PLC)
533模拟量速度给定(利用S7-300 PLC)
54变频器的通信速度给定
541MM440变频器通信的基本知识
542S7-200 PLC与MM440变频器的USS通信速度给定
543S7-300 PLC与MM440变频器的场总线通信速度给定
544S7-300 PLC通过PROFIBUS现场总线修改MM440变频器的参数
第6章西门子S7-300/400 PLC的故障诊断技术
61PLC控制系统的故障诊断概述
611引发PLC故障的外部因素
612PLC的故障类型和故障信息
613PLC故障诊断方法
614PLC外部故障诊断方法
62S7-300/400 PLC故障诊断技术
621使用状态和出错LED进行故障诊断
622用STEP7快速视图进行故障诊断
623用通信块(如SFB15)的输出参数/返回值(RET_VAL)诊断故障
624用组织块的故障诊断
625用SFC13进行故障诊断
626各种故障诊断的比较
63工程常见调试和故障诊断30例
第7章西门子PLC其他应用技术
71高速计数器的应用
711高速计数器简介
712高速计数器在转速测量中的应用
72其他技巧/难点
721安装STEP7 注意事项
722创建和使用S7-200 PLC的库函数
723指针的应用
724自定义数据类型UDT的应用
第8章西门子PLC工程应用案例
81压力数据采集PLC控制系统
811系统软硬件配置
812编写控制程序
82物料搅拌机PLC控制系统
821系统软硬件配置
822编写控制程序
83定长剪切机PLC控制系统
831系统软硬件配置
832编写控制程序
84啤酒灌装线系统PLC控制系统
841系统软硬件配置
842编写控制程序
85往复运动小车PLC控制系统
851系统软硬件配置
852编写控制程序
参考文献
识别下列二维码,寻找更多好书:
相关问答
plc应用?
PLC在国内外已广泛应用于钢铁、石油、化工、电力、建材、机械制造、汽车、轻纺、交通运输、环保及文化娱乐等各个行业。可编程控制器简称PLC,是专门为工业控...
plc运算处理功能?
简单可编程逻辑控制器的运算功能包括逻辑运算、计时和计数功能;普通可编程逻辑控制器的运算功能还包括数据移位、比较等运算功能;较复杂运算功能有代数运算...
plc编程和上位机编程区别?
PLC编程和上位机编程是两种不同的编程方式,主要区别如下:1.设备类型:PLC编程是指对可编程逻辑控制器(PLC)进行编程,而上位机编程是指对上位机进行编程,上...
plc分类?
PLC(可编程逻辑控制器)根据其功能和特点可以分为多个分类。其中,按照规模可分为小型PLC、中型PLC和大型PLC;按照应用领域可分为工业PLC、建筑PLC和交通PLC;...
PLC最高段位是什么
一级(高级技师)一、可编程序控制系统(PLC)培训鉴定对象1、从事电气或自动化工程设计、维护的技术人员。2、从事电气或自动化设备、工控设备维护和维修...
电气自动化需要哪些高级语言?
电气自动化需要哪些高级语言?市面上高级语言挺多,好用的也挺多。工业自动化里常见到的有VB,C++,C#等等。需要哪些?一般一个公司要求并不多,熟悉一种就好。...
作为一名电工如何提升工控技能?变频器、plc、触摸屏选择学哪个?哪个更有发展前途?
可以不往编程设计哪方面走,可走维修方面的路。首先触摸屏是上位机显示和操作的界面,这基本没什么难点,就是一些控件的使用,掌握基本的就可以,一些高级操作...你...
三菱fx1splc用电脑编程?
三菱fx1splc用电脑的编程方法USB-SC09是三菱PLC的编程电缆,在使用前你首先要安装编程电缆的驱动程序,在安装驱动结束后,你要进行简单的设定。设定方法如下。...
末流985刚毕业的自动化专业,现在在学上位机plc做电气工程师方面的工作,这种有前途吗,还是去考研啊?
这么多建议做it的?我就是学电气做it的,互联网行业竞争特别厉害,年龄大了就被优化,我今天还面试了一个来做中控的,四十多了,说以前做程序员出身,以前学的现...
高级电工证plc考什么?
高级电工证是职业资格证的分级,对应的是三级电工,但是三级资格证是不考PLC知识的,如果你考的是二级或者一级职业资格证的话,我上次参加考试题目是浮球高低限...